Happy Thanksgiving, City may have offloaded turkey!


It has been a while since we have spoken about the Rebel without a cause, Carlos 'I'm a celebrity get me out of here' Tevez. I know you were all wondering what happened to the Argentinian after he was evicted from the big brother house. Well after missing training and deciding to take an impromptu holiday in Argentina I though the guys career was over. I mean who would want to pay this guys wages and have him disrupt the team as he does? The answer, the same team that took Robinho!

Reports broke on the American Thanksgiving holiday that the Italian side were in talks with Tevez advisors, Kia Joorabchian. If that isn't something to be thankful for then I don't know what is. I could make a comment about turkeys but that may be taking it to far, the guy was a hero at Manchester last season. 

The Rossoneri will probably be willing to pay a fee of around 25 million for the Argentine, which is significantly less than the 40 million tag he had in the summer. Although with Robinho, Pato, Ibramovic, Inzaghi and Cassano already fighting for first team football I am unsure as to whether he will not just be warming their bench. What's that? Take Pato in exchange? We could do that, unless you see anyone else you like in their squad? 

Whatever the outcome it seems that I was wrong and Tevez still may be able to collect interest from other big teams and with Italy being so much closer to Argentina I am sure his life will suddenly be filled with rainbows and unicorns! 

The majority of City fans will just be glad to see the back of him at this point with his off field antics and disruption to the team (in regards press conference questions revolve around the guy rather than how well the team is doing). It now seems that his building of cult status with the City faithful has been somewhat diluted if not totally contaminated by the last two months. City need to offload this dead weight and January can not come quick enough providing this is to happen.
